ch.qos.logback.core.joran.spi.Interpreter@4:102 - no applicable action for [springProperty], current ElementPath is [[configuration][springProperty]]
时间: 2023-12-14 07:03:30 浏览: 38
这是一个 Logback 日志框架的错误信息,它报告说在解析配置文件时遇到了一个名为 "springProperty" 的元素,但是没有找到相应的处理方法。可能是由于配置文件中缺少相关的依赖或配置不正确导致的。建议检查配置文件和依赖是否正确,如果问题仍然存在,可以尝试在搜索引擎上搜索该错误以获取更多信息。
相关问题
ERROR in ch.qos.logback.core.joran.spi.Interpreter@5:80 - no applicable action for [springProperty], current ElementPath is [[configuration][springProperty]]
这个错误可能是因为你在Logback的配置文件中使用了`springProperty`标签,但是Logback并不支持这个标签。
如果你想要在Logback中使用Spring的属性,可以尝试使用`<springProperty>`标签来代替。例如:
```
<springProperty name="myProperty" source="my.property.key"/>
```
这个标签会将Spring环境中`my.property.key`属性的值赋值给Logback的`myProperty`属性。你需要确保在使用`<springProperty>`标签之前已经正确地配置了Spring。
Logback configuration error detected: ERROR in ch.qos.logback.core.joran.spi.Interpreter@4:89 - no applicable action for [springProperty], current ElementPath is [[configuration][springProperty]]
这个错误是因为 Logback 配置文件中使用了不支持的标签 `springProperty`,它不是 Logback 的标签。你需要检查 Logback 的配置文件,将不支持的标签 `springProperty` 替换成 Logback 支持的标签,或者删除这个标签。如果你需要在 Logback 配置文件中使用 Spring 属性,可以使用 Logback 的 `springProfile` 标签来实现。例如:
```
<springProfile name="dev">
<appender name="FILE" class="ch.qos.logback.core.FileAppender">
<file>log/development.log</file>
<encoder>
<pattern>%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n</pattern>
</encoder>
</appender>
</springProfile>
```
在上面的配置中,`<springProfile>` 标签会根据 Spring 的配置文件中的 `spring.profiles.active` 属性来选择性地加载配置。如果当前的 `spring.profiles.active` 属性为 `dev`,则会加载 `<springProfile name="dev">` 中的配置。